Shaab Ambar
Overview
Ambar Reef is a large horseshoe-shaped reef around a lagoon.
Description
It is a massive reef system that stretches for 5 km, with a lagoon in the middle that is ideal for night dives and overnight stays.
At the southeastern end is a very nice plateau, where on the sandy flats, in moderate currents, surgeonfish, hunting barracuda, large tuna, sand eels and small whitetip reef sharks can be found.
At the drop off, if the current allows it, you can see schools of hammerheads and gray reef sharks.
